Before looking into the specifics of butterflies in dreams, it’s crucial to recognize the broader context of dreams as divine messages. Throughout the Bible, God frequently used dreams to communicate with His people. For instance, in Genesis 37:5-10, Joseph’s dreams foretold his future rise to prominence and his family’s eventual bowing down to him. Dreams are not merely random occurrences but are often laden with spiritual significance and symbolism, inviting us to seek understanding and discernment.

Transformation and Renewal

  1. Symbolism of TransformationButterflies are widely recognized as symbols of transformation and renewal, reflecting the metamorphosis they undergo from caterpillar to butterfly. This profound change can represent spiritual growth and transformation. In 2 Corinthians 5:17, it is written, “Therefore, if anyone is in Christ, the new creation has come: The old has gone, the new is here!” Dreaming of butterflies can signify a period of significant personal or spiritual change, reminding us of God’s power to renew and transform us.
  2. Spiritual Renewal and New BeginningsButterflies also symbolize new beginnings and spiritual renewal. Just as a butterfly emerges from its cocoon, so too can we emerge from periods of hardship or stagnation into a new phase of life. In Isaiah 43:19, God says, “See, I am doing a new thing! Now it springs up; do you not perceive it?” Dreaming of butterflies can be a message of hope, indicating that God is bringing about new opportunities and a fresh start.

Freedom and Ascension

  1. Symbolism of FreedomButterflies, with their delicate wings and graceful flight, symbolize freedom and the ability to rise above earthly concerns. In John 8:36, it is stated, “So if the Son sets you free, you will be free indeed.” Dreaming of butterflies can signify liberation from burdens, anxieties, or sin, reminding us of the freedom we have in Christ.
  2. Elevation and Spiritual AscensionThe flight of a butterfly can also symbolize spiritual ascension and a closer connection to God. As butterflies ascend into the sky, they can represent our own spiritual journey towards higher understanding and a deeper relationship with God. In Colossians 3:1, believers are encouraged to “set your hearts on things above, where Christ is, seated at the right hand of God.” Dreaming of butterflies can be a call to focus on spiritual growth and ascension.

Joy and Beauty

  1. Symbolism of JoyButterflies are often associated with joy and beauty, reflecting their vibrant colors and graceful movements. In Psalm 30:11, the psalmist writes, “You turned my wailing into dancing; you removed my sackcloth and clothed me with joy.” Dreaming of butterflies can be a reminder of the joy and beauty that God brings into our lives, even amidst challenges.
  2. Appreciation of God’s CreationThe beauty of butterflies can also remind us to appreciate God’s creation and the intricate designs He has woven into the natural world. In Psalm 104:24, it is written, “How many are your works, Lord! In wisdom you made them all; the earth is full of your creatures.” Dreaming of butterflies can inspire awe and gratitude for the beauty and wonder of God’s creation, encouraging us to take time to appreciate the world around us.

Dream Actions and Their Significance

The actions associated with butterflies in your dream can significantly influence their interpretation. Here are some common dream scenarios and their potential meanings:

  • Seeing a Butterfly: Generally symbolizes positive change, new beginnings, or a sense of hope. The butterfly’s color and behavior can offer further clues.
  • Catching a Butterfly: Represents capturing an opportunity for growth or a chance to embrace positive change.
  • Letting a Butterfly Go: Letting go of something that no longer serves you, releasing limitations, or surrendering to a situation.
  • Being Chased by a Butterfly: Fear of change or transformation, resistance to new experiences or opportunities.
  • A Butterfly Landing on You: A sign of good luck, receiving unexpected blessings, or feeling a connection to your intuition.
  • A Butterfly in Your Hand: Having control over your own transformation or feeling empowered to embrace change.
  • Killing a Butterfly: Destroying opportunities for growth, hindering your own progress, or stifling creativity.

By reflecting on your specific dream actions and emotions, you can gain a deeper understanding of the message your subconscious might be sending.

Butterfly Characteristics and Symbolism

The vibrant colors of butterflies often hold symbolic meaning in dreams. Consider the specific color of the butterfly that graced your dreamscape:

  • Black Butterfly: Can symbolize transformation, mystery, or endings. Black butterflies are not inherently negative; they might represent the end of a phase to make way for new beginnings.
  • White Butterfly: Often associated with purity, innocence, and new beginnings. It might represent a fresh start, a spiritual connection, or a message from the spirit world.
  • Yellow Butterfly: Symbolizes joy, optimism, and creativity. It might be a sign to embrace your creative side or maintain a positive outlook on life.
  • Blue Butterfly: Represents peace, tranquility, and wisdom. A blue butterfly might encourage calmness amidst challenges or suggest a need for introspection.
  • Red Butterfly: Signifies passion, strong emotions, or transformation with intensity. A red butterfly might represent a passionate new relationship or a period of intense change.

By considering the color of the butterfly in conjunction with other dream elements, you can gain a more nuanced understanding of its significance.

Examples from the Bible

  1. The Transformation of Paul (Acts 9:1-19)The story of Paul’s transformation on the road to Damascus is a powerful example of spiritual renewal and change. Once a persecutor of Christians, Paul became one of the most influential apostles after his encounter with Christ. This transformation reflects the metamorphosis symbolized by butterflies, showcasing God’s power to change and renew us.
  2. The Exodus and New Beginnings (Exodus 12:31-42)The Exodus of the Israelites from Egypt represents a profound new beginning and liberation from bondage. This story aligns with the symbolism of butterflies emerging from cocoons, signifying new opportunities and spiritual renewal brought about by God’s intervention.
